The narrow streets of Edinburgh can be challenging to navigate, especially for drivers who aren't experienced. The streets in the city center are often lined with cobblestones and crowded at the peak hours. During your driving lessons you should practice maneuvers like hill starts and manoeuvring tight turns. Be aware of steep slopes on the hills of Edinburgh, which can make it difficult to turn onto a narrow street.

Closes are narrow streets that connect buildings along the Royal Mile, and other streets in the Old Town. They provide access to buildings or access to the street's front doors. Some of these closed have been restored and are now open to the accessible to the public. Some are named after famous people of the past, such as Mary King's Close.

The COVID-19 Pandemic has affected almost all aspects of everyday life. This includes traffic patterns and travel systems. The impact of the lockdown was evident long before the official launch of the stay-at-home order, with many cities already experiencing a dramatic decrease in traffic volumes even before the pandemic began to take effect. It also has led to a significant reduction in traffic-related accidents.

One of the main factors behind this is the reduced speeds resulting from the 20mph speed limit interventions. In a city-wide analysis the statistically significant reduction in mean speed was observed at 12 months post-intervention. A shift in the distribution of overall speeds was also observed, with a decrease in both lower and higher speeds. The reductions were similar to those found in studies of 20mph zones. However, there is less evidence to support the effectiveness of such zones at the city or town level.

These results support the hypothesis stating that reducing the average speed could improve urban environments. This could be due to a decrease in collisions and accidents, or the impact on other aspects such as the liveability.
